On Key Integrate

Integrating On Key with the rest of the world

Remove manual data transfers. Automate system to system integration. Create a connected enterprise application landscape.

On Key Integrate is a standardised system-to-system integration solution. It is based on best practices, and it includes monitoring and maintenance of the integrations.

Brochure

Integrate

Spare Part integration

Integrate On Key EAMS’ work management process with your ERP. Spare part demand is created in the work management cycle in On Key EAMS. Once a requisition is approved, a corresponding requisition or purchase request must be generated in the ERP system.

The purchasing cycle will then be managed in the ERP system. When spare parts are issued or returned, the transaction is captured in the ERP system and transferred back to On Key.

A typical spare part integration will consist of the following data flows:

  • Master data must be synchronised
  • Approved requisition in On Key EAMS will trigger a corresponding requisition in the ERP system
  • Issues and returns created in the ERP system will be transferred back to On Key EAMS

Standard Connectors

On Key Integrate uses world leading iPaas platform and integration technology, and is one of a handful of iPaas technologies that support both cloud and on-premise integrations with enterprise level security.

On Key Integrate has a vast selection of technology and application connectors and so provides faster, simpler and more efficient integration between business units, customers and partner ecosystems.

Some of the standard supported connectors include:

  • SAP
  • Acumatica
  • Microsoft Dynamics 365
  • Office 365
  • Sage
  • Syspro

The Integrated On Key Plus Solution

Comprehensive RESTful API: On Key offers a complete RESTful API enabling all data insert, update, delete, read, and other actions to be performed programmatically. This gives clients maximum flexibility to integrate On Key with other systems within their enterprise architecture.

Full Automation Capability: All actions that can be applied to records through the User Interface are also available via the RESTful API, ensuring full flexibility and automation capability.

Predictable and Secure Communication: The API uses predictable, uniform resource URLs with secure HTTPS-based transfer protocols. JSON is used for both request and response bodies, ensuring compatibility and ease of use.

Standardised Authentication: On Key uses OAuth2 authentication through OpenID Connect 1.0 compliant Identity Providers, ensuring secure and standardised access.

Extensive Developer Documentation: Developers can access comprehensive documentation, including a full Swagger specification with example calls. [Developer documentation link: https://core-za.onkey.app/contoso/prd/docs/]

Advanced Customisation: The API supports resource customisations and advanced user-defined SQL queries, allowing clients to tailor the data extracted through the API to meet their specific needs.

Use Cases: On Key seamlessly integrates with major ERPs like SAP or Syspro, enhancing enterprise resource planning capabilities. Automate document handling, approval flows, and work management validations. For example, tickets from external systems can be integrated into On Key as work orders. On Key is IoT-ready, allowing for integrating monitoring and meter reading data from external systems via the APIs.

Developer Experience: Full Swagger specification with example calls is available as part of the API documentation, streamlining the development process. Multiple clients have successfully used the APIs to develop custom integrations in-house or through third-party services.

Error Handling: The API uses standardised HTTP response codes and includes data-level detail in responses when applicable, ensuring clear and effective error handling.

Regular Updates: The API is updated with each major release. Detailed changelogs are available in the documentation, informing developers of new features and changes.

Real-World Adoption: Many clients are already leveraging the APIs to create custom integrations, demonstrating the robustness and versatility of the On Key Plus solution.


Key Benefits

  • Single platform that supports cloud-to-cloud, cloud-to-on-premise, and on-premise-to-on-premise integrations.
  • A comprehensive library of connectors coupled with support for various integration patterns enable the development of any integration with exceptional speed.
  • Reusable business logic and data flow recommendations simplify the integration process and error resolution.
  • Real-time monitoring and alerting bundled into a Managed Integration Service.

    How did you hear about us?